WebHistory. The priory dedicated to St. Mary was built on land granted to Mary, daughter of King Stephen.In 1148, the nuns of St Sulphice-la-Foret, Brittany, moved to Higham. Higham priory was also known as Lillechurch. On 6 July 1227, King Henry III confirmed the royal grant to the abbey of St. Mary and St. Sulpice of Lillechurch.. WebThe Thames and Medway Canal is a disused canal in Kent, south east England, also known as the Gravesend and Rochester Canal.It was originally some 11 km (6.8 mi) long and cut across the neck of the Hoo peninsula, linking the River Thames at Gravesend with the River Medway at Strood.The canal was first mooted in 1778 as a shortcut for military …
WebTQ 77 SW HIGHAM GRAVESEND ROAD. 3/48. The Little Hermitage. II. Early C19 of stuccoed brick, this 2-storey house comprises the central block of a. larger house the side wings of which have been demolished. Low pitched slated roof. with deeply overhanging eaves. Gads Hill Place was bought by Charles Dickens, Jr. after his father's death, but he was forced to give it up in 1879 because of his own ill-health and financial difficulties. The civil parish of Higham is in Gravesham district and as at the 2001 UK Census, had a population of 3,938.
